What is the Periodontal Cleaning Meaning?

Periodontal cleaning is a deep cleaning method that removes plaque and tartar from both above and below the gum line. It differs from regular dental cleaning. It cleans the pockets between the teeth and gums but is deeper. This cleaning type treats gum disease and prevents tooth loss.

When comparing periodontal cleaning vs. regular cleaning, the primary difference lies in the depth of the cleaning procedure. Removal of surface stains and tartar above the gum line is a focus of routine cleaning. Periodontal cleaning is deeper. It concentrates on removing bacteria and buildup below the gums. It is very effective in treating infected gums and protecting other structures that support the teeth.

Periodontal cleaning is usually required in cases where gum pockets are deeper than 3 millimeters. Harmful bacteria love to hide within these deep pockets. If not treated, such bacteria lead to gum diseases, bone loss, and worst of all, tooth loss. That’s why dentists recommend periodontal cleaning at the first signs of gum problems.

Periodontal Cleaning Procedure

The periodontal cleaning procedure begins with an evaluation of your gums. The dentist uses some instruments to measure the depth of pockets around your teeth. To assess the extent of bone loss and tartar deposit in the area under the gum line, they may take X-rays.

Scaling and root planing are two essential steps in the actual cleaning process. During scaling, the dentist removes all the tartar and bacteria from your tooth surfaces and from below your gums. Root planing comes next after this, in which they smooth out rough surfaces on tooth roots. To ensure you feel no pain, the dentist uses local anaesthesia.

The periodontal cleaning cost in Delhi depends on many factors. These include: 

  • The number of affected teeth.
  • The severity of gum disease.
  • The location of the clinic.
  • The experience of the dentist.

Treatment generally ranges from INR 1,500 to INR 5,000 per quadrant. The majority of dental insurance plans only pay a percentage of the total treatment cost. To learn more about your payment choices, schedule an appointment with your dentist.

Benefits of Periodontal Cleaning

Periodontal cleaning offers numerous health benefits beyond just cleaning teeth. Some of them are:

  1. Prevents Gum Disease and Tooth Loss
    Periodontal cleaning procedure removes hazardous bacteria that cause gum disease. It prevents the growth of the infection down to the gum tissues. It also helps in preventing future loss of teeth. Hence, this deep cleaning saves your teeth.

  2. Reduces Health Complications
    Some health issues are actually related to gum disease, according to studies. Periodontal, a part of good oral care, reduces heart disease risks. It also assists in the management of blood sugar in diabetic patients. The treatment also helps to minimise the chances of respiratory infections.

  3. Enhances Smile and Breath
    Bad breath is usually caused by bacteria. Periodontal cleaning removes these bacteria and their hiding spots. The procedure makes teeth appear whiter and cleaner. It also assists in achieving healthier-looking gums and thus a better smile. Some patients get rid of bad breath immediately after the treatment.

  4. Saves Money in the Long Run
    Early treatment through periodontal cleaning prevents costly dental procedures later. It assists in preventing costly procedures such as implants or surgery. It helps to maintain natural teeth for longer periods. This is less expensive than treating late-stage gum diseases.

  5. Boosts Overall Oral Health
    Periodontal cleaning meaning not only clean but enhances overall oral health. It helps maintain proper bite alignment by preventing tooth movement. The procedure also helps in decreasing the inflammation and bleeding of the gums. This kind of care results in long-term oral health improvement.

Deep Periodontal Cleaning After Care

Periodontal cleaning aftercare is crucial in getting the best outcome from the procedure. Just like:

  • Do not consume hot foods or beverages for the first 24 hours after the treatment.
  • Use a soft-bristled toothbrush and rinse with warm salt water as suggested.
  • If provided with any medication, then ensure to take it and follow the course of antibiotics if given.
  • Practice good oral hygiene, but do not be too rough on your gums.
  • Avoid tobacco and smoking, as they reduce the rate of healing.

It is extremely important to adhere to any or all periodontal cleaning aftercare tips that your dentist gave you. Regular follow-up appointments allow you to monitor your recovery process.

What to Expect After Periodontal Cleaning?

Some temporary sensitivity is normal after the procedure. You may also experience sensitivity of the teeth to hot and cold foods and beverages. Your gums might become a little sore, and you may have some slight discomfort when chewing food. Slight bleeding during brushing is also common in the first few days.

Duration of most periodontal sensitivity decreases within a week. Complete gum healing usually takes two to three weeks. Following good oral hygiene practices helps speed up the healing process. If the discomfort lasts more than a week, you should make an appointment with your dentist. Even if you have heavy bleeding or if you notice any type of swelling.

Prevention is crucial for achieving and maintaining results. Brush your teeth at least twice a day, and floss often. Rinse your mouth with antiseptic mouthwash as recommended by your dentist. Visit the dentist at least once in six months. A well-balanced diet that includes less sugary foods promotes dental health.
